Kan. Admin. Regs. § 69-12-16 - Lamps
(a) Each
tanning facility shall use only tanning devices manufactured in accordance with
the specifications set forth in 21 CFR Part 1040, Section 1040.20, as in effect
on September 6, 1985, "Sunlamp products and ultraviolet lamps intended for use
in sunlamp products."
(b) Each
sunlamp product or ultraviolet lamp used in these facilities shall not emit any
measurable Ultraviolet C radiation.
(c) Each ultraviolet lamp contained within
the sunlamp product shall be shielded to avoid contact with the consumer .
(d) Services and repair shall be
carried out by a competent person in accordance with the information supplied
with the device.
(e) Defective or
burned out tanning lamps or bulbs shall be replaced with a type intended for
use in that device and shall be of the same ultraviolet range, A or B, as the
manufacturer specifies, and shall be the original lamp type as specified by the
manufacturer, or an equivalent lamp approved by the FDA .
